The BGCC/BBBS Mentoring Program involves eleven Club sites and more than 200 mentors and youth. Mentor matches meet once a week at a Club engaged in a variety of activities:
-
Talking
-
Playing games and sports
-
Doing homework
-
Creating art projects
-
Sharing general life experiences
-
Getting involved in team-building activities
-
Field trips with other mentor/mentee pairs.
Matches
receive the support of both the Big Brothers Big Sisters Program
Coordinator, who facilitates each mentoring session, and the Boys
& Girls Clubs staff, who interact with the children and their
families on a regular basis.
BGCC Mentoring is funded through the generous contributions of the Regenstein Foundation and Kraft Foods, Inc.
